Poop that changes in consistency during a bowel movement is usually a sign of an unbalanced microbiome. “The first treatment step is to add in a good probiotic ,” says Dr. Rossman. “Every veterinarian has an opinion on what probiotics they prefer, and they are not created equally. WebOct 14, 2024 · 4. Stress. If your Golden Retriever is stressed---such as from being in a kennel all day long---he might resort to snacking on some feces. 5. Punishment. If you punish your Golden Retriever for pooping in the house, the chances are that he might start thinking of poop as ‘ evidence’ and just eat it to save himself!
